  2. Mei's entire kit is about disruption and being as aggravating as possible to the enemy team. So yeah. She's pretty not-fun to play against. But you can deal with her. Bleck's advice is solid. Above all, you have to keep your distance unless you're positive you can kill her before she freezes you. Her projectile attack is strong but it has delay and its velocity isn't as fast as a bullet. If you're a good shot, McCree can counter her reasonably well due to his good range on his primary and his flashbang if she does manage to close the distance to you. Soldier 76 can work in a pinch too at medium to long range, but his pulse rifle's damage might not pile up fast enough to kill her without blowing your Helix Rockets. Widowmaker obviously is a decent choice against her too, given her predilection for long-range combat. Needless to say, Pharah can be a nightmare for Mei, especially if you can maximize air time so she has to rely solely on her alternate fire to bring you down. Just don't pop rocket barrage if she knows where you are and keep moving erratically and you should have the advantage there. If you're in a situation where you're a short range character, your options are more limited. Reaper and Tracer have escapes, as does Winston, and should be used liberally if you're in a disadvantageous situation. I've had some success with Reinhardt against Mei thanks to the large health pool and shield, and if you have a good sense of timing, his charge can level a Mei coming out of Ice Block if they don't wall up the instant they get out. Even if you flub the charge and hit the block, you're still in hammer range, and with a teammate backing you, you should be able to finish her if you land at least one swing. Relatedly, I've found that against low to mid level Meis, that saving your burst damage for after she ice-blocks tends to punish her reasonably well. But I don't play all that often and Meis may have gotten smarter since then. And importantly, I want to stress what Bleck said: when facing one or more Meis, stay with your team. Ganging up on her if she's out of position is one of the best ways to deal with her. Without her ult, she can generally only freeze/headshot one of you at a time. She may be sturdy, but she probably won't have enough health to weather two or three people wailing on her before she goes down.

  9. The answer to this is surprisingly simple and realistic. In the desert, there's an abundance of sand... which is blown around very easily by the wind. The Mjolnir armor has moving parts and joints, that sort of thing. Sand constantly blowing into the armor will require it to be cleaned and maintained more, and if he has no access to the tools required to maintain it, it results in degradation of armor performance. Covering it with that robe protects the surface and potentially vulnerable spots of the armor from sand blowing around. Notably, Zero does the same thing during the opening of Mega Man Zero 2. That and it was to conceal him for a big reveal, but at least it makes sense.
